SKEPTIC


Meaning of SKEPTIC in English

adj ·alt. of skeptical.

2. skeptic ·noun one who is yet undecided as to what is true; one who is looking or inquiring for what is true; an inquirer after facts or reasons.

3. skeptic ·noun a person who doubts the existence and perfections of god, or the truth of revelation; one who disbelieves the divine origin of the christian religion.

4. skeptic ·noun a doubter as to whether any fact or truth can be certainly known; a universal doubter; a pyrrhonist; hence, in modern usage, occasionally, a person who questions whether any truth or fact can be established on philosophical grounds; sometimes, a critical inquirer, in opposition to a dogmatist.
